Bornwell Mwape commences physiotherapy

By The ZamFoot Crew | February 5, 2020

Napsa forward Bornwell Mwape has commenced his physiotherapy sessions as he continues his road to recovery.

The former Nkana striker underwent a knee arthroscopy two weeks ago. Napsa Stars confirmed the development on their official social media platforms.

The team medical duo confirmed to Napsa Stars FC Media team that Bornwell is expected to do his physio for two weeks before the player starts his light training.

Mwape last featured for the Pensioners in their 2-all draw match against Green Buffalos FC where he was stretchered off with a left knee injury.

The forward is Napsa Stars leading goalscorer this season with 6 goals to his credit.
